Confirmation-Page Tracking Code (Pixels & Analytics)
A reservation is a conversion. Marketing teams running ads on Google, Meta, or TikTok need that conversion fired back to the ad platform so campaigns can learn from it. Without this signal, budget optimizes on page views instead of actual bookings — a huge efficiency hit.
Confirmation-Page Tracking Code lets you paste any custom HTML or script that should fire when the booking is successfully confirmed. Meta Pixel's Purchase event. Google Ads conversion snippet. GA4 custom event. TikTok Pixel. A raw img-beacon to a third-party tool. Whatever the ad stack expects — drop it in, and it fires once per confirmed booking.
The code runs after the reservation is written to the database, so you know the conversion is real. You can template reservation data into it (party size, date, total if a deposit was paid) so the event carries value — useful for ROAS reporting. The snippet sits on the venue settings and is edited in one place, no developer needed.
Add-only: you keep the rest of the site clean, the tracking lives where it matters — on the success of the booking.
